摘要:
AbstractA number of proteins from a silver‐stained two‐dimensional (2‐D) electrophoresis gel of mouse liver whole‐cell lysate were identified by peptide mass mapping and sequene database searching. The excised protein spots were processed byin situreduction and alkylation, followed by Lys‐C digestion. The masses of the resulting peptide mixtures were measured with a matrix‐assisted laser desorption/ionization (MALDI) reflectron‐time‐of‐flight mass spectrometer. These masses were used successfully to search a protein sequence database. Optimized silver staining and digestion protocols allowed proteins to be identified routinely at the low picomole level. The high mass accuracy and resolution provided by delayed extraction were important for high specificity in the database search.
